Asylum seekers in makeshift Jungle camp in France seek British Eldorado

Home for the past year has been a blue Tarpaulin in a makeshift camp on wasteland known as the Jungle. Every lunchtime Ehsan eats a sandwich distributed by a local charity and every evening he tries to cling on to a lorry heading for Britain. He has never made it past the port. â??My luck is out,â?...
